Output c9af0ddd19df6ef1db6b3e03a7ed1f63308d65c5c5d2ed47c102e186841408b6:3

value
78158243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cd4b465430ad2bdcb7dc142a422f04b16139e9 OP_EQUAL
address
33rsQ33Bs3589BCE3YsvzqMZ7g7W3gvUEX
transaction
c9af0ddd19df6ef1db6b3e03a7ed1f63308d65c5c5d2ed47c102e186841408b6
confirmations
546680
spent
true